  • May 14, 2011
    Neal McCoy sings "No Doubt About It" for the first dance at Blake Shelton and Miranda Lambert's wedding reception in Boerne, Texas. Martina McBride sings "Stand By Your Man"; Lambert, Kelly Clarkson and Reba McEntire do "Little Rock"
    May 17, 2011
    Mentor Blake Shelton, with Reba McEntire at his side, picks team member Jared Blake to move on to the next round after a performance of "Ain't No Mountain High Enough" on the NBC-TV competition "The Voice"
    May 22, 2011
    Reba McEntire, Jean Shepard and songwriter Bobby Braddock are inducted into the Country Music Hall of Fame
    May 25, 2011
    Reba McEntire and Blake Shelton hold the first of two benefits for Oklahoma tornado victims at the Choctaw Event Center in Durant, opening with a duet on "Oklahoma Swing." The shows raise $500,000
    May 26, 2011
    Surprise guest Kelly Clarkson sings "Don't You Wanna Stay" with Blake Shelton at the Choctaw Event Center in Durant, Oklahoma, where Shelton and Reba McEntire are co-hosting a benefit
    May 31, 2011
    "Turn On The Radio" songwriter Cherie Oakley meets Reba McEntire for the first time as a contestant on NBC's "The Voice." After singing "Since You Been Gone," Oakley is cut from the competition
    Jun 10, 2011
    Jake Owen makes a surprise appearance at the CMA Music Festival to do a duet with Keith Urban at Nashville's LP Field on "Don't Think I Can't Love You." Also on the bill: Reba McEntire, Lady Antebellum, Sugarland and Dierks Bentley
    Jun 14, 2011
    Reba McEntire and Narvel Blackstock are on hand for son Shelby Blackstock's Formula Tour 1600 Grand Prix race in Montreal
    Jul 24, 2011
    Reba McEntire, Garth Brooks and Miley Cyrus perform during the Starkey Foundation Gala at the River Centre in St. Paul, Minnesota. Also attending: John Rich, Kevin Costner and Gary Busey
    Jul 31, 2011
    Rascal Flatts sings the national anthem for the Brickyard 400 at the Indianapolis Motor Speedway, where Reba McEntire, The Band Perry, Justin Moore, Brantley Gilbert and Thomas Rhett also perform. Paul Menard wins the race
